An experienced and passionate composer and sound designer who strives for excellence in every project

Matthew Steed is a musical composer with 7 years of professional experience within the film industry and video game industry, where he has also contributed to sound design and Fx. He has over 20 years experience in the music industry overall.

In 2019 he was awarded 'best score' at Sleepy Hollow Film Festival, NY for his work on indie horror comedy "Driven" staring Richard Speight Jr.

He has had work displayed at some of the most prominent video game conventions in the world including ComicCon, Gamescom, EGX, Tokyo Games Show and Bitsummit. 'Tokyo Dark' in particular, which was released originally through Square Enix and re-released with additional content through Sony in 2019, has been one of Matt's most critically acclaimed titles. The soundtrack was separately released as a stand alone title, due to popular demand.

Matt completed a 6 month internship at MMO Magic in California at the beginning of his career. He has since placed 2 production music albums with Position Music and worked on a wide range of video game, film and tv titles. His style is widely varied and can easily be adapted to suit all genres.

Matthew's goal is to continue to progress into the AAA games and mainstream film industries.
